HELPFUL HINTS FOR FILLING OUT THE 2009 CHARGE CONFERENCE

FLORENCE DISTRICT LAY SPEAKER ANNUAL REPORT:

 There are three requirements to be recognized as a Lay Speaker

1.  Recommendation by Local Church

                  2.  Submit complete, accurate, and timely report

                  3.  Update training as required

Part 2: STATUS OF THE LAY SPEAKER

FIRST TIME:

I am applying to:

BEGIN as a local church lay speaker

This applies to a person who wishes to be recognized as a Local Church Lay speaker (A Local Church Lay Speaker serves as a Lay Speaker at their home church only, after completing the BASIC course).  At Charge Conference, this person either anticipates completing the BASIC course at the next training session, or has recently completed the BASIC course.

Their report must be accurately filled out, signed, and submitted to the pastor in time to be submitted to the District Superintendent at the pastor’s consultation.  Otherwise during the interim between Charge Conferences, the Pastor or Administrative Board may vote to recommend them for the BASIC course only.

             NOTE:  This box can be skipped if the person has, pre Charge Conference, already completed the BASIC course and has already taken an ADVANCED course or anticipates taking an ADVANCED course at the next training and is requesting becoming a Certified Lay Speaker.

   

FIRST TIME:

I am applying to:

BECOME a certified lay speaker

                          This applies to a person who wishes to become a certified lay speaker (who is allowed and may volunteer to be called on to speak at their home church and at other churches in the District).  At Charge Conference, this person has had the BASIC course and recently completed  an ADVANCED course or anticipates completing an ADVANCED course at the next training date. An Advanced course must be taken every three years.

                          This person may let the District Director of Lay Speaking Ministries know that they are willing to be available outside of their Local Church. 

                          Their report must be accurately filled out, signed, and submitted to the pastor in time to be submitted to the District Superintendent at the pastor’s consultation.  If they are not recommended at Charge Conference they must wait to be recognized and made available as a Certified Lay Speaker at their church’s next Charge Conference.

 

RENEWAL:

I am applying for renewal as a:

local church lay speaker

        This applies to a person who wishes to remain a local church lay speaker.  They have previously been recommended as a Local Church Lay Speaker.

        Their report must be accurately filled out, signed, and submitted to the pastor in time to be submitted to the District Superintendent at the pastor’s consultation.  If they are not recommended at Charge Conference their renewal must wait until their church’s next Charge Conference.

       The 2008 Book of Discipline ¶267 states that Local Church Lay Speakers will be required to take a refresher course every three years.  The Florence District Offered the Refresher Class 10/07; 10/08; 3/09.

        NOTE:  Anyone who has taken the BASIC and an Advanced course is considered “A Certified Lay Speaker”.  However, they may choose to only serve their local church.  Please advise the District Director of Lay Speaking Ministries of your wishes.

 

RENEWAL

I am applying for renewal as a:

certified lay speaker

           This applies to a person who has been recommended as a certified lay speaker at a previous Charge Conference. At the current Charge Conference, this person has had BASIC, and an ADVANCED COURSE in the past three years. 

        Their report must be accurately filled out, signed, and submitted to the pastor in time to be submitted to the District Superintendent at the pastor’s consultation.  If they are not recommended at Charge Conference their renewal must wait until their church’s next Charge Conference.

 

 

LAYSPEAKERS MUST POST THEIR LAST ADVANCED CLASS WITH MONTH/YEAR.  IF THEY TAKE A CLASS AT WHITE OAK OR AS AN INSTRUCTOR IT MUST BE LISTED THAT WAY.  IF A CLASS IS TAKEN IN ANY OTHER DISTRICT, THE DISTRICT MUST BE POSTED.
